Header cannot be opened or does not match mplayer
 
Running fedora 2

I seem to be unable to access apt.sw.be in the last few days and
dag-rpm.mirrors.redwire.net/fedora/$releasever/en/$basearch/dag
gives me header errors on some packages
E.g. (after removign h t t p because of LQ's spam controls)
retrygrab() failed for:
dag-rpm.mirrors.redwire.net/fedora/2/en/i386/dag/headers/mplayer-0-1.0-0.11.pre5.1.fc2.dag.i386.hdr
Executing failover method
failover: out of servers to try
Error getting file dag-rpm.mirrors.redwire.net/fedora/2/en/i386/dag/headers/mplayer-0-1.0-0.11.pre5.1.fc2.dag.i386.hdr
[Errno -1] Header cannot be opened or does not match mplayer, i386.


Anybody have any clue other than that maybe the header is corrupted on the DAG site?
